To be quite honest..Sweetface got a killing from fans and critics alike.. and i thought the collection was'nt that bad of a debut - it embodied Jennifer's idea of "style"..the stereotypical exubrant celebrity lifestyle complete with fur, sequins and diamonds. The clothes themselves were'nt always executed in the right way and the show was completley exagarated with the wind.. glittering runway but sweetface had more potential. There is something i just dont like about LAMB...its more like a duplicate and imitation of Gwen's wadrobe and "look"..and various other "inspirations" from her favourite designers like Westwood and Galliano.
